What is another word for not reported?

Pronunciation: [nˌɒt ɹɪpˈɔːtɪd] (IPA)

There are various synonyms for the term "not reported", which can be used to convey the same meaning in different contexts. Some of the examples include "unstated", "unannounced", "undisclosed", "unspecified", "unrecorded", "unmentioned", "untold", "unreported", "uncounted", "omitted", "neglected", "ignored", and "overlooked". These synonyms can be used in different ways, depending on the context in which the information is being presented. For instance, "unreported" may be used in a news context, while "undisclosed" may be used in the context of a legal case. Understanding the nuances of each synonym can be beneficial in effectively expressing one's thoughts and ideas.

What are the opposite words for not reported?

Antonyms of the word "not reported" can vary depending on the context of the situation. However, some possible antonyms are published, revealed, disclosed, announced, publicized, proclaimed, disseminated, broadcasted, exposed, and unveiled. These words suggest that something has been made known to the public or has been officially shared with a wider audience. Antonyms for "not reported" can be particularly useful in the news and media industry, where the timely and accurate dissemination of information is essential. Using antonyms can help convey a sense of transparency and openness, while also providing clarity and context for readers, listeners, or viewers.
